July 2012 FDA Recall Drug by Mallinckrodt Inc
D-1692-2012 - Labeling

This Class III drug recall was voluntarily initiated by Mallinckrodt Inc on July 30, 2012 for the product Drug. The FDA reported the reason for recall as labeling. The product was distributed in AZ, CT, MO, MS, PA, FL, WA, NC, CA, TX, OK and the recall is currently terminated.

Thallous Chloride Tl 201 Injection, Diagnostic Sterile, Non-Pyrogenic Solution, a) 2.8 mL (NDC 0019N12028) b) 6.3ml (NDC 0019N12063) For Intravenous Administration, each milliliter contains 37 MBq (1 mCi) Thallous Chloride Tl 201 (no carrier added) at date and time of calibration, 9 mg sodium chloride and 0.9% (v/v) benzyl alcohol as a preservative, RX, Mallinckrodt Inc., St. Louis, MO 63134
